What is the smart way to order Small Plates in a restaurant?

How many? Is it rude to order just 2 and save room for dessert? Do you order an appetizer before them? Would you recommend small plates at all? Do they all come at once?

I think there is no rule for this. Probably restaurants that serve this way vary greatly. From my experience, I appreciate being able to taste more things, so I enjoy it. Really, it's like having an assortment of appetizers. Look at other tables to see how much food is served on a 'plate,' or ask the waiter for some guidelines. You know your appetite and hunger level, so order accordingly. And save room for dessert? Sounds good to me!
